Congratulations to Trudie Procter, who has been nominated for one of the England Netball 'Goalden Globes' awards.
The Muriel McNally award is presented annually to a volunteer who has made an outstanding contribution to the development of netball at grassroots level for 10 years or more. Trudie has certainly done that in this area, through her work both at the club and in schools - particularly All Cannings Primary School, which has an unmatched record of success at the County High Five finals.
Trudie will be attending the South West Goalden Globe Awards 2012, which are being held at Brickleigh Castle in Tiverton on July 1st. Winners from there will be put forward for the National award, which will be announced at the National Goalden Globe Awards 2012, on 22nd September.
